Morten Lillemo is a leading figure in plant breeding and phenomics, with a research focus on integrating robotics and unmanned aerial vehicles (UAVs) into high-throughput field phenotyping. His most-cited work, "Exploring Robots and UAVs as Phenotyping Tools in Plant Breeding" (2017, 53 citations), demonstrates his pioneering contributions to non-destructive, cost-efficient plant trait assessment. By combining VIS/NIR multispectral imaging from UAVs and ground-based robots with traditional manual measurements, Lillemo has advanced the ability to survey large plant populations rapidly and accurately. This work bridges the gap between sensor technology and practical breeding programs, enabling more precise selection for traits like disease resistance and yield. His research has significant implications for accelerating crop improvement in the face of climate change and food security challenges. Lillemo’s innovative approach to phenotyping has established him as a key contributor to the digital transformation of plant breeding, with his methods increasingly adopted by researchers worldwide.
